Krishnamurti's Philosophy of Uncertainty
Jiddu Krishnamurti’s observation highlights the creative and transformative power hidden within uncertainty. He cautions against the allure of certainty, which often masks a rigid, closed mindset. Instead, Krishnamurti invites us to dwell within the unknown, suggesting that true growth and new possibilities await those who resist the deceptive comfort of predetermined answers.
Innovation and the Unknown
Building on Krishnamurti’s insight, history demonstrates that innovation flourishes amid uncertainty. Scientific revolutions—from Copernicus challenging the geocentric model to Einstein’s theory of relativity—arose by questioning established ‘certainties.’ By venturing into uncharted intellectual territory, pioneers unlocked vistas of possibility that certainty alone could never provide.
The Psychological Comfort of Certainty
Transitioning from the external world to our inner lives, humans are naturally inclined to seek security. The feeling of certainty acts as a psychological shield against anxiety, offering the illusion of control. However, as Krishnamurti warns, this tendency suppresses curiosity and flexibility, qualities essential for adaptation and personal growth—echoed by psychologist Carol Dweck’s research on growth mindsets.
Creativity Born from the Depths of Doubt
In the artistic realm, uncertainty serves as a rich wellspring for creativity. Writers, painters, and musicians often embrace doubt as part of their process—much like Rainer Maria Rilke’s Letters to a Young Poet (1929), in which he urged living the questions rather than seeking premature answers. Here, uncertainty becomes not a void to escape, but a space where imagination takes root.
Practical Wisdom: Navigating Life’s Unknowns
Ultimately, Krishnamurti’s perspective offers practical wisdom for daily life. By accepting uncertainty, individuals remain open to change and new opportunities. Rather than clinging to the illusion of security, we become more resilient and responsive to life’s unpredictable challenges. In this way, uncertainty transforms from a source of fear into a catalyst for discovery and growth.
